Paint Your Kitchen Instead of Replacing It: A Wollongong Painter’s Take

A new kitchen can cost you forty grand. A painted one can look just as fresh for a fraction of that. After years of doing both kinds of jobs around Wollongong, here’s why we so often tell people to paint before they rip everything out.

You can get a brand-new look for around 10% of the cost. Instead of spending $40,000 on a full replacement, you can paint the kitchen, seal it properly, and walk away with something that looks brand new for a fraction of the price. We can do it one clean tone throughout, or two tones — say a different colour on the bottom cabinets to the top — which looks fantastic and modern. Swap the handles and hardware while you’re at it and the whole thing feels far more premium. For what it costs, the difference is hard to believe.

But you have to use the right paint. This is the part people get wrong when they try it themselves. Normal paint is too soft for a kitchen — it scratches and chips, and within months it looks worse than when you started. We use a proper kitchen-range paint that’s hard and durable, made to handle daily use without scratching. That’s the whole secret to a kitchen respray that actually lasts.

Tired benchtops? You might not need to replace those either. If your benchtops are timber, we can put an epoxy coating over the top that genuinely looks great. We can even mix colours to give it a marble look. We’ve done this for plenty of clients and we always hear the same thing back — that it looked amazing, and they couldn’t believe they’d nearly spent forty grand on a whole new kitchen to get a similar finish.

If you’ve been staring at a dated kitchen and dreading the cost of replacing it, get a painter to look at it first. Often the answer is a weekend’s work and a few hundred dollars of the right materials — not a full renovation.
